Product Description
Himod FT7293 is a tubular, low density, polyethylene grade for the production of packaging film.

Compared to standard LDPE grades, the Himod LDPE products provide a combination of higher stiffness and improved optical properties. Benefits can be obtained in terms of better down gauging possibilities and improved processability. Excellent printing quality is obtained due to high clarity and better layflat.

Himod FT7293 is intended for applications like:
  • Stiff films with excellent optical properties for automated packaging machinery
  • Lamination film/food packaging
  • Textile packaging films
  • Magazine packaging

Additional Information
The value listed as Melting Temperature, ISO 3146, was tested in accordance with ISO 11357/03.
Puncture Reistance, Force, ASTM D5748, 40 µm blown film: 29 N
Puncture Reistance, Energy, ASTM D5748, 40 µm blown film: 0.4 J
Coefficient of Friction (Dynamic), ISO 8295: 0.4
